It is based on changes in #41. It will be a smaller PR after #41 is merged
[x] Example of appropriate REST integration tests are added (only a test that makes sense to do as an integration test and not as a unit test only)
[x] The tests are executed during the CI build (locally on Linux in CircleCI)
[x] The REST API integration tests are run against the sample API deployed to z/OS
They are deployed to River and using port 20080 that has been opened on the firewall. Multiple builds are serialized during the z/OS integration test step using z/OSMF REST API header X-IBM-Obtain-ENQ on PUT /zosmf/restfiles/ds call
[x] Use class inheritance for integration tests classes to eliminate code repetition (comment by @VitekVlcek-Broadcom )
Resolves #31
It is based on changes in #41. It will be a smaller PR after #41 is merged
X-IBM-Obtain-ENQ
onPUT /zosmf/restfiles/ds
call